Infectious complications associated with hairy cell leukemia
The Journal of Infectious Diseases
|May 1, 1981
Summary
Patients with hairy cell leukemia face significant infectious complications, particularly those with lower granulocyte counts. Prompt diagnosis and management of infections are crucial for survival in these patients.

Background:
- Hairy cell leukemia (HCL) is a rare B-cell malignancy.
- Infections are a major cause of morbidity and mortality in HCL patients.
- Understanding infection patterns and risk factors is vital for improving patient outcomes.
Purpose of the Study:
- To review infectious complications in patients with hairy cell leukemia.
- To identify risk factors associated with serious infections in HCL.
- To assess the impact of infections on patient survival.
Main Methods:
- Retrospective review of 47 patients diagnosed with hairy cell leukemia.
- Categorization of patients into groups based on infection status: culture-documented, clinically significant, or no serious infections.
- Analysis of granulocyte counts and infection types (pyogenic vs. nonpyogenic).
Main Results:
- 17 patients had culture-documented infections, 13 had clinical infections, and 17 had no serious infections.
- Pyogenic infections accounted for 64% of documented infections.
- Patients with serious infections had significantly lower initial median granulocyte counts (P < 0.05).
- 10 of 17 patients with documented infections died from their infections.
- Disseminated atypical mycobacterial disease occurred in 9% of patients, with 50% surviving long-term.
Conclusions:
- Infectious complications pose a significant threat to patients with hairy cell leukemia.
- Lower granulocyte counts are associated with an increased risk of serious infections.
- Infections are a primary cause of mortality in HCL patients.
- Timely diagnosis and treatment of infections, including atypical mycobacterial disease, are critical for improving survival rates.
